I have a similar issue, when i rev engine smoothly, it stucks at 4k-ish RPMs, like it does launch control with 30rpm swing. RPM gauge peaks or drops randomly etc.
On the other hand when I rev the engine hard (or when RPM passes 4k-ish RPMs, it can goes to RPM limit without any error.
1.tried calculate pull up/down resistor values according to CPS sensor datasheet
2.tried with 4 MRE ECUs with same build, and ECUs with different filtering settings (adding filtering caps and/or resistor or without any pull-up/down resistors or any capacitors (PS: it is going bad without any resistors. don't try))
3.tried different CPS sensor bracket (for case of mechanical problem)
4.tried different CPS sensor distances (from 0.3mm to 1mm)
5.tried different CPS sensors (1 new and 1 used-from a working car)
6.tried changing signal pin to CAM hall input.
7.tried machining the wheel for balance and uneven surfaces
8.tried different firmwares
9.tried to get log but i couldn't make it. obviously im not good at using softwares
Tomorrow I will check raw sensor data with oscilloscope and make a new CPS bracket from aluminium. Maybe iron bracket is magnetizing the sensor?, i want to be sure.
-it is a 4A-F (carburateur) to 4A-FE conversion project and i could not find the original trigger wheel so i used BMW 60-2. Will post tune and logs when i could.
